FEN
[Event "casual classical game"]
[Site "https://lichess.org/sA8egGXl"]
[Date "2026.04.22"]
[Round "-"]
[White "Tim0117"]
[Black "lichess AI level 1"]
[Result "1-0"]
[GameId "sA8egGXl"]
[UTCDate "2026.04.22"]
[UTCTime "15:22:37"]
[WhiteElo "1500"]
[BlackElo "?"]
[Variant "Standard"]
[TimeControl "10800+180"]
[ECO "C20"]
[Opening "Portuguese Opening"]
[Termination "Normal"]
[Annotator "lichess.org"]
1. e4 { [%eval 0.18] } 1... e5 { [%eval 0.22] } 2. Bb5 { [%eval -0.21] } { C20 Portuguese Opening } 2... c6 { [%eval -0.2] } 3. Bc4 { [%eval -0.55] } 3... Nf6 { [%eval -0.54] } 4. Nh3?? { (-0.54 → -2.67) Blunder. Nf3 was best. } { [%eval -2.67] } (4. Nf3 Nxe4 5. Nxe5 d5 6. Be2 Bd6 7. Nf3 O-O 8. O-O Bf5) 4... b5? { (-2.67 → -1.17) Mistake. Nxe4 was best. } { [%eval -1.17] } (4... Nxe4 5. d3 Nf6 6. Qe2 Be7 7. Qxe5 O-O 8. O-O d5 9. Bb3) 5. Bb3 { [%eval -0.89] } 5... d6 { [%eval -0.37] } 6. f4?? { (-0.37 → -4.38) Blunder. Ng5 was best. } { [%eval -4.38] } (6. Ng5 d5 7. d4 exd4 8. e5 Nfd7 9. e6 fxe6 10. Nxe6 Qe7 11. Qh5+ g6) 6... exf4?? { (-4.38 → -0.73) Blunder. Bg4 was best. } { [%eval -0.73] } (6... Bg4 7. Bxf7+ Ke7 8. Qxg4 Nxg4 9. Bb3 Ke8 10. O-O Qb6+ 11. Kh1 Nd7 12. Nc3) 7. Rf1? { (-0.73 → -2.44) Mistake. Nf2 was best. } { [%eval -2.44] } (7. Nf2 d5 8. d4 a5 9. a4 dxe4 10. Bxf4 bxa4 11. Rxa4 Ba6 12. c4 Bb4+) 7... Qe7?! { (-2.44 → -1.34) Inaccuracy. Bg4 was best. } { [%eval -1.34] } (7... Bg4 8. Rf3 d5 9. exd5 Be7 10. Nxf4 cxd5 11. h3 Bxf3 12. Qxf3 Nc6 13. Nxd5) 8. Rxf4 { [%eval -1.52] } 8... h6 { [%eval -1.17] } 9. Rxf6? { (-1.17 → -2.59) Mistake. d3 was best. } { [%eval -2.59] } (9. d3 g5 10. Rf1 Bg7 11. Kf2 a5 12. a4 O-O 13. Kg1 Ng4 14. axb5 Qe5) 9... Qxe4+?! { (-2.59 → -1.49) Inaccuracy. Qxf6 was best. } { [%eval -1.49] } (9... Qxf6 10. Nf2 Be7 11. d4 O-O 12. Nc3 a5 13. a4 b4 14. Ne2 d5 15. e5) 10. Kf1 { [%eval -1.62] } 10... Be6?? { (-1.62 → 3.91) Blunder. gxf6 was best. } { [%eval 3.91] } (10... gxf6 11. Nf2 Qh4 12. d4 a5 13. Nd2 a4 14. Qe2+ Kd8 15. Bxf7 f5 16. Nd3) 11. Bxe6 { [%eval 3.59] } 11... Kd8?! { (3.59 → 4.88) Inaccuracy. gxf6 was best. } { [%eval 4.88] } (11... gxf6 12. Bg4 h5 13. Nf2 Qg6 14. Bh3 Nd7 15. d4 Bh6 16. Nd2 Nb6 17. Qf3) 12. Ng5? { (4.88 → 2.78) Mistake. Nc3 was best. } { [%eval 2.78] } (12. Nc3 Qe5 13. Rf2 Qxe6 14. Nf4 Qe8 15. Qf3 g5 16. Nd3 Bg7 17. b3 Nd7) 12... Qb4?? { (2.78 → 7.28) Blunder. hxg5 was best. } { [%eval 7.28] } (12... hxg5 13. d3 Qe5 14. Rxf7 Qxe6 15. Bxg5+ Ke8 16. Rf4 Nd7 17. Nd2 Rxh2 18. Kg1) 13. Nxf7+ { [%eval 7.44] } 13... Ke8 { [%eval 8.09] } 14. Nxh8 { [%eval 7.47] } 14... Be7 { [%eval 8.81] } 15. Ng6 { [%eval 7.03] } 15... Qd4 { [%eval 9.47] } 16. Rf8+ { [%eval 7.4] } 16... Bxf8 { [%eval 7.34] } 17. Qe1 { [%eval 6.22] } 17... Na6 { [%eval 6.95] } 18. Bf7+?? { (6.95 → 2.75) Blunder. Bh3+ was best. } { [%eval 2.75] } (18. Bh3+ Kd8 19. Nxf8 Qf4+ 20. Kg1 Qxf8 21. d3 Kc7 22. Be3 Re8 23. Nc3 Kb7) 18... Kd8?? { (2.75 → 6.34) Blunder. Kxf7 was best. } { [%eval 6.34] } (18... Kxf7 19. Qh4 Qc5 20. Qe4 Qg5 21. Nh4 d5 22. Qf5+ Kg8 23. Qe6+ Kh7 24. Nf3) 19. Qe5?? { (6.34 → -5.70) Blunder. Qf2 was best. } { [%eval -5.7] } (19. Qf2 Qxf2+ 20. Kxf2 Be7 21. Ke2 Bf6 22. Na3 Rb8 23. c3 Rb7 24. Bg8 Nc5) 19... Qd3+?? { (-5.70 → 6.13) Blunder. dxe5 was best. } { [%eval 6.13] } (19... dxe5 20. Nxf8 Ke7 21. Ne6 Qg4 22. Nc3 Kxf7 23. d3 Kxe6 24. Be3 Nb4 25. h3) 20. Ke1 { [%eval 5.33] } 20... Qxg6?! { (5.33 → 7.05) Inaccuracy. dxe5 was best. } { [%eval 7.05] } (20... dxe5 21. cxd3 Nb4 22. Kd1 Nxd3 23. Nxf8 Ke7 24. Bg6 Nf2+ 25. Kc2 Rxf8 26. Nc3) 21. Qe8+ { [%eval 7.11] } 21... Kc7 { [%eval 7.04] } 22. Bxg6 { [%eval 6.82] } 22... Rc8 { [%eval 8.59] } 23. Bf5?? { (8.59 → 3.68) Blunder. Qf7+ was best. } { [%eval 3.68] } (23. Qf7+ Kb8 24. d4 Nc7 25. Nc3 b4 26. Ne2 Nd5 27. c4 Nf6 28. Bf4 a6) 23... g6?? { (3.68 → Mate in 13) Checkmate is now unavoidable. Rxe8+ was best. } { [%eval #13] } (23... Rxe8+ 24. Kd1 Re7 25. Bg4 Rf7 26. Ke1 Re7+ 27. Be2 Nb4 28. Na3 Nd5 29. g3) 24. Qd7+?! { (Mate in 13 → 10.13) Lost forced checkmate sequence. Qxc8+ was best. } { [%eval 10.13] } (24. Qxc8+ Kb6 25. Qd8+ Nc7 26. Qb8+ Kc5 27. Qxc7 gxf5 28. d3 Be7 29. Qxa7+ Kd5) 24... Kb8?! { (10.13 → Mate in 1) Checkmate is now unavoidable. Kb6 was best. } { [%eval #1] } (24... Kb6 25. Qxc8 gxf5 26. Qxf8 h5 27. Na3 h4 28. d3 h3 29. gxh3 Kb7 30. Qf7+) 25. d4? { (Mate in 1 → 7.80) Lost forced checkmate sequence. Qxc8# was best. } { [%eval 7.8] } (25. Qxc8#) 25... Rd8? { (7.80 → Mate in 3) Checkmate is now unavoidable. gxf5 was best. } { [%eval #3] } (25... gxf5 26. Bf4 Rc7 27. Qe8+ Rc8 28. Qxf8 Rxf8 29. Bxd6+ Nc7 30. Bxf8 Nd5 31. Bxh6) 26. Bf4? { (Mate in 3 → 7.30) Lost forced checkmate sequence. Qxd8+ was best. } { [%eval 7.3] } (26. Qxd8+ Kb7 27. Bc8+ Kb8 28. Bxa6#) 26... Be7? { (7.30 → Mate in 6) Checkmate is now unavoidable. Rxd7 was best. } { [%eval #6] } (26... Rxd7 27. Bxd7 g5 28. Bd2 Kc7 29. Bh3 Bg7 30. c3 b4 31. Ke2 c5 32. Be3) 27. Bxd6+ { [%eval #5] } 27... Ka8 { [%eval #1] } 28. Qxe7 { [%eval #6] } 28... gxf5 { [%eval #6] } 29. Qxd8+ { [%eval #5] } 29... Nb8 { [%eval #1] } 30. Bxb8 { [%eval #2] } 30... b4 { [%eval #2] } 31. Qc7 { [%eval #1] } 31... h5 { [%eval #1] } 32. Qb7+? { (Mate in 1 → 9.46) Lost forced checkmate sequence. Qxa7# was best. } { [%eval 9.46] } (32. Qxa7#) 32... Kxb7 { [%eval 9.41] } 33. Na3 { [%eval 9.1] } 33... Kc8 { [%eval 9.21] } 34. Nb5 { [%eval 9.08] } 34... a5 { [%eval 9.2] } 35. Na7+ { [%eval 9.27] } 35... Kd7 { [%eval 10.03] } 36. d5 { [%eval 8.79] } 36... h4? { (8.79 → Mate in 8) Checkmate is now unavoidable. cxd5 was best. } { [%eval #8] } (36... cxd5 37. Rd1 h4 38. Rxd5+ Ke8 39. Rd3 a4 40. Nc6 h3 41. gxh3 a3 42. bxa3) 37. dxc6+ { [%eval #8] } 37... Kd8 { [%eval #7] } 38. c7+ { [%eval #6] } 38... Ke7 { [%eval #6] } 39. c8=Q { [%eval #5] } 39... a4 { [%eval #4] } 40. b3 { [%eval #5] } 40... Kf6 { [%eval #5] } 41. bxa4 { [%eval #6] } 41... Kg6 { [%eval #5] } 42. a5 { [%eval #5] } 42... Kf6 { [%eval #5] } 43. a6 { [%eval #5] } 43... f4 { [%eval #4] } 44. Nc6 { [%eval #4] } 44... h3 { [%eval #4] } 45. a7 { [%eval #5] } 45... b3 { [%eval #4] } 46. a8=Q { [%eval #4] } 46... bxa2 { [%eval #3] } 47. Rxa2 { [%eval #4] } 47... Kg5 { [%eval #3] } 48. gxh3 { [%eval #3] } 48... Kh5 { [%eval #3] } 49. Ra5+ { [%eval #2] } 49... Kh4 { [%eval #1] } 50. Ra3 { [%eval #3] } 50... f3 { [%eval #1] } 51. Rxf3 { [%eval #3] } 51... Kh5 { [%eval #2] } 52. h4 { [%eval #3] } 52... Kxh4 { [%eval #2] } 53. Rf4+ { [%eval #2] } 53... Kh5 { [%eval #2] } 54. Qf5+ { [%eval #2] } 54... Kh6 { [%eval #2] } 55. Ne7 { [%eval #2] } 55... Kg7 { [%eval #2] } 56. h3 { [%eval #1] } 56... Kh6 { [%eval #1] } 57. h4 { [%eval #2] } 57... Kg7 { [%eval #2] } 58. h5 { [%eval #1] } 58... Kh6 { [%eval #1] } 59. Ng8+ { [%eval #1] } 59... Kg7 { [%eval #1] } 60. h6+ { [%eval #1] } 60... Kh8 { [%eval #1] } 61. Qf6+ { [%eval #1] } 61... Kh7 { [%eval #1] } 62. Qe4+ { [%eval #1] } 62... Kxg8 { [%eval #1] } 63. h7# { White wins by checkmate. } 1-0